Early Life and Background

Adrienne Lois Rodriguez was born on March 9, 1950, in Mexico. When she was still young, her family moved to the United States, where she grew up and built her life. Not much is known about her parents or siblings, as Adrienne always kept her private life away from the public eye. What we do know is that she grew up with a deep love for music. From a very young age, she had a strong passion for singing and writing songs.

Adrienne briefly attended the University of Florida, though she left after a short time to follow her passion for music more directly. She later worked as a hair stylist on a movie set, which is actually how she crossed paths with the man who would change her life forever.

How She Met James Brown

In 1981, Adrienne was working as a hair stylist on a film set when she first met James Brown. At the time, Brown was already one of the most famous musicians in the world, known for hits like “I Feel Good” and “Papa’s Got a Brand New Bag.” The two connected, and after a few years of knowing each other, they got married in 1984.

From that moment on, Adrienne’s life changed completely. She went from living a quiet, private life to suddenly being in the spotlight as the wife of a global superstar. People saw them together at public events and award shows, and on the surface, they looked like a powerful couple.

Marriage to James Brown

Their marriage lasted over a decade, from 1984 until Adrienne’s death in 1996. During that time, the couple had three children together: Terry, Teddy, and Larry. However, behind the glamour and public appearances, the marriage was far from easy. James Brown was accused of assaulting Adrienne on multiple occasions during their time together.

One of the most well-known incidents took place in 1988, when Adrienne filed charges against Brown for assault. The news shocked many people. However, the couple eventually reconciled, and Adrienne chose to stay with him. They separated again in April 1994, but they never officially divorced. Despite all the struggles, Adrienne remained committed to the marriage until the very end.

Death and the Mystery Surrounding It

On January 4, 1996, Adrienne underwent a liposuction procedure at a Beverly Hills health facility. Two days later, on January 6, 1996, she suddenly collapsed while recovering. She was rushed to Century City Hospital in Los Angeles, where doctors pronounced her dead. She was just 45 years old.

The official cause of death was listed as congestive heart failure. Doctors stated that the cosmetic surgery itself was not determined to be the direct cause. However, the mystery did not end there. Her close friend, Jacque Hollander, never accepted the official explanation and spent years pushing for a deeper investigation. She suspected foul play and continued to contact Beverly Hills police even two decades after Adrienne’s passing. No official investigation ever confirmed those suspicions, and the full truth behind her death remains unclear to this day.
